Tuition Refund Policy

All students must officially withdraw from classes in order to receive a full or partial refund.  To officially withdraw, a student must complete a Drop/Add/Withdrawal form and turn it in to the Student Records Office located on the Airport and Beltline campus.

Web enabled students may officially withdraw via the web through the end of schedule change. After schedule change, students must come to either the Airport or Beltline Student Center Records Office.

Payment will be required if a student does not attend class(es) (no show) and does not officially withdraw.  Students will be billed for classes and the debt will be processed through the College's collection procedures, if payment is not received.

Refunds will take approximately 3-4 weeks to process.  The amount of the refund will be based on when the completed form is received by the Students Records Office, according to the Institutional Refund Schedule below.  All fees are non refundable.

  • Students must process the Drop/Add/Withdrawal Form during the established timeframe to be eligible for a refund of tuition.

  • The effective date of the student-initiated withdrawal will be the date the form is received in the Records Office.

  • Courses will be deleted from the system for students who process the Drop/Add/Withdrawal Form during the 100% refund period, and no grade will appear on the student's transcript.

The amount of the refund will be based on the date the completed form is received by the Records Office, according to the following schedule:

Withdrawal or Net Reduction of Credit Hours Percent of Refund
For Full Term
1st - 5th instructional day of the term
 100%
6th - 10th instructional day of the term
 50%
11th - 15th instructional day of the term
 25%
After 15th instructional day of the term
  0%


Refunds for terms that vary in length from the semester term (i.e. Summer, Session I & II, Fast Track I & II, 10 Week Sessions, Weekend, and 7 Week Session) will be in proportion to the semester term refund schedule. Specific dates and percentages for each term are listed in the Class Schedule and on the Midlands Technical College webpage on "Refunds."

Federal Financial Aid Recipients


Students who receive federal financial aid will earn the entire award after 60% of the term has been completed.

 

Partial Withdrawals

Credit balance for tuition refunds to federal financial aid recipients will not be issued until the student completes 60% of the term.
 

Complete Withdrawals

  • Any student who completely withdraws prior to 60% of the term will owe a portion of tuition and fees to the college, based on the length of time the student was enrolled.  Immediate repayment is required.

  • A student may also owe the federal government a portion of federal funds disbursed.  Immediate repayment may be required.
